Man Found Dead in Laurel, Police Confirm Incident as Suspicious

LAUREL, Md. — Detectives are investigating the suspicious death of an adult male found early Tuesday morning in a residential area of Laurel, according to the Laurel Police Department.

Officers responded to the 1000 block of Marton Street at 4:18 a.m., where they discovered the victim. The man’s identity has not been released, and the circumstances surrounding his death remain unclear.

The department stated that the Office of the Chief Medical Examiner will determine the exact cause and manner of death.

Authorities said the investigation is ongoing and no further details have been confirmed. It is not yet known whether foul play is suspected.

In a statement, police said, “As more information is confirmed it will be released to the public.”
